7 min Reading

How Data Annotation Drives the Future of AI: Uncovering Its Role and Benefits

The rapid rise of artificial intelligence (AI) has sparked remarkable advancements across industries, from healthcare to finance. But behind every int

author avatar

0 Followers
How Data Annotation Drives the Future of AI: Uncovering Its Role and Benefits

The rapid rise of artificial intelligence (AI) has sparked remarkable advancements across industries, from healthcare to finance. But behind every intelligent system, there’s a foundational process that enables AI to understand and make decisions: data annotation.


This process involves labeling raw data such as text, images, and audio to help machine learning models interpret and learn patterns. In this article, we will explore the critical role of data annotation, the different types, and its benefits to businesses and industries alike.


As AI continues to evolve, the demand for data annotation will only increase. By the end of this article, you'll have a deeper understanding of how this process shapes AI and why it's essential for building robust, effective, and intelligent systems.


What is Data Annotation?


Data annotation is the process of labeling data to add meaning to it, enabling AI models to interpret and act on that data. Simply put, data annotation involves tagging raw information with contextual labels that machine learning models can use to learn and make decisions. This is essential for training AI systems, which rely on high-quality labeled data to develop accurate and efficient algorithms.


For example, in the context of self-driving cars, data annotation is used to label images and videos with elements like traffic signs, pedestrians, and lanes. The car's AI system can then learn to identify and respond to these elements, ensuring safe navigation on the roads.


The Key Types of Data Annotation


Different types of data require different kinds of data annotation to help AI models understand their content. Let's look at the most common types:


1. Image Annotation (Computer Vision)


In computer vision (CV), data annotation refers to labeling images or videos. This can involve labeling objects, people, or scenes to enable AI to identify these elements in real-world applications like surveillance, security, and autonomous vehicles.

  • Object Detection: Identifying specific objects in an image (e.g., cars, people).
  • Image Segmentation: Dividing an image into regions and assigning labels to each segment.
  • Face Recognition: Annotating facial features for identification and security purposes.


2. Text Annotation (Natural Language Processing)


Data annotation is also critical in natural language processing (NLP), where the focus is on labeling text data. This could involve classifying sentiment, identifying key phrases, or categorizing documents.

  • Sentiment Analysis: Tagging text as positive, negative, or neutral based on the emotions expressed.
  • Named Entity Recognition (NER): Labeling entities like names, dates, or locations.
  • Text Classification: Categorizing text into predefined groups, such as spam vs. non-spam.


3. Audio Annotation


Data annotation in the audio domain involves labeling sound clips for voice recognition or emotion detection. It's crucial for applications like voice assistants or sentiment analysis in customer service interactions.

  • Speech-to-Text: Converting spoken language into written form.
  • Emotion Detection: Identifying emotions based on voice tone.
  • Sound Classification: Tagging specific sounds, such as sirens or alarms, for various industries.


How Data Annotation Powers AI Models


Data annotation provides the foundation for AI systems to perform accurate tasks. The more high-quality annotated data that AI systems have access to, the better they perform. Here’s how it powers AI:


1. Enabling Machine Learning


Machine learning algorithms depend on data to make decisions and predictions. The quality of the data directly influences the performance of AI models. Data annotation ensures that the data is not just raw but is labeled in a way that allows models to learn patterns and improve over time.

For example, a machine learning model trained on annotated images of fruits will learn to differentiate between apples, bananas, and oranges. As a result, the AI can then recognize these fruits in new, unannotated images with high accuracy.


2. Improving Accuracy


AI models are only as good as the data they are trained on. If the data annotation is inconsistent or inaccurate, the AI’s predictions will be unreliable. Proper annotation ensures that the model learns the correct information, improving its ability to make precise decisions.


3. Streamlining Processes


Data annotation simplifies the data processing pipeline. Annotating data provides a clear structure, making it easier for businesses to use data in AI training and deployment. Efficient data annotation tools speed up the process, enabling businesses to leverage AI quicker.


Data Annotation’s Role Across Industries


The applications of data annotation span multiple industries, demonstrating its versatility and importance in AI development. Here’s how it’s transforming various sectors:


1. Healthcare


In healthcare, data annotation is essential for developing AI models that can assist in diagnostics, such as detecting tumors or identifying diseases from medical imaging. Annotated medical images help train AI systems to recognize patterns in X-rays, MRIs, and CT scans, making it possible for doctors to diagnose diseases more accurately and quickly.


2. Retail


E-commerce businesses use data annotation to improve product recommendations and personalize the shopping experience. Annotating product images with key attributes (like color, size, and brand) allows AI systems to provide better search results and recommendations, improving the customer experience.


3. Automotive


The automotive industry heavily relies on data annotation for autonomous vehicle development. By annotating images from cameras installed on cars, companies can teach AI systems to recognize road signs, pedestrians, and obstacles, enabling the vehicle to navigate autonomously.


Why Data Annotation is Crucial for AI Development


Accurate and high-quality data annotation is crucial for the success of AI models. Here’s why:


1. Increased Efficiency


Properly annotated data ensures that AI systems can process information quickly and effectively. It reduces the need for constant model retraining and fine-tuning, saving time and resources for businesses.


2. Faster AI Deployment


With well-annotated data, AI systems can be trained faster, leading to quicker deployment. Businesses can bring their AI-powered products and services to market sooner, gaining a competitive advantage.


3. Scalable AI Solutions


High-quality data annotation allows AI systems to scale efficiently. As the data volume grows, AI models can continue to learn and improve without compromising performance. This scalability is crucial for businesses aiming to expand their AI capabilities.


Tools Used for Data Annotation


Several tools help businesses streamline their data annotation process. These tools offer features that make annotation more accurate and efficient. Let’s explore some popular options:


1. Labelbox


Labelbox is a cloud-based platform that provides advanced annotation tools for images, videos, and text. It offers features like AI-assisted labeling, making the process faster and more accurate.


2. CVAT (Computer Vision Annotation Tool)


CVAT is an open-source, web-based platform designed specifically for computer vision tasks. It supports various annotation types, including bounding boxes, segmentation, and key point labeling.


3. Prodigy


Prodigy is a powerful tool for text, image, and audio annotation. It focuses on active learning, enabling AI models to request annotations for uncertain data points, making the annotation process more efficient.


Ensuring Consistency and Accuracy in Data Annotation


The accuracy and consistency of annotated data directly impact the performance of AI models. To ensure high-quality annotations, businesses can implement the following strategies:


1. Inter-Annotator Agreement


Inter-annotator agreement (IAA) is a measure of how consistently multiple annotators label the same data. By tracking IAA, businesses can ensure that their annotations are consistent, reducing errors and biases.


2. Quality Control Measures


A robust quality control process ensures that any inconsistencies in the data are caught and corrected before they affect the AI model. This can involve reviewing data labels manually or using automated tools to identify discrepancies.


The Future of Data Annotation


As AI continues to evolve, the need for data annotation will only grow. With advancements in AI technology, new annotation techniques will emerge, especially in areas like 3D data labeling and augmented reality (AR). The demand for annotated data will increase across industries like healthcare, finance, and robotics, making data annotation a critical component in shaping the future of AI.


Conclusion: The Power of Data Annotation in AI Development


In conclusion, data annotation is the backbone of AI and machine learning. It turns raw data into valuable labeled information that enables AI models to learn and make decisions. Whether it's enhancing self-driving cars, improving healthcare diagnostics, or personalizing e-commerce experiences, data annotation plays a crucial role in creating intelligent systems that drive innovation and growth.


As businesses continue to adopt AI and machine learning, investing in high-quality data annotation will be key to their success. By using the right tools and strategies, businesses can ensure that their AI models are accurate, reliable, and capable of providing real-world value.

Top
Comments (0)
Login to post.